  • David Goodman and Don Nolan join Clark Wolf on Savoring Sonoma: The Hour (Aired: November 27, 2022)

    David refbDon PD porterDavid Goodman, Executive Director, and Don Nolan, Kitchen Collective Chef, head up the key efforts at Sonoma County’s Redwood Empire Food Bank.
     
    Beyond the staff of (80+) they work with an astonishing 10,000 volunteers to gather, produce, and offer thousands and thousands of meals to so many in our community who experience food insecurity.
     
    Join host Clark Wolf as he talks food and community with these two stellar citizens.

  • David Stebenne Joins Suzanne Lang for A Novel Idea (Aired: November 1, 2020)

    stebenneDavid Stebenne unwraps how the middle class was created but then could not hold in his book Promised Land, How the Rise of the Middle Class Transformed America, 1929-1968. Stebenne details the social, economic, and political realities that picked us up from the Great Depression, especially if you were white and male, and by the 1950’s had hoisted the country into prosperity with a burgeoning middle class; by 1968 the cracks were too wide to ignore, and the country has been yearning and grumbling ever since. David is a specialist in modern American political and legal history, is widely published, teaches at Ohio State University, and joins Suzanne M. Lang in conversation, Sunday, November 1st at 10am on KRCB’s A Novel Idea.

  • Deborah Bertolucci on Savoring Sonoma (Aired: February 26, 2023)

    deb final Cropped330pxDeborah Bertolucci is Superintendent of Geyserville Schools, Head of the Geyserville Career Technical Education (CTE) program, and Principal of the Geyserville New Tech Academy.

    Her students get to learn about food and farming and life in a way that prepares them for a career in agriculture and a variety of food-related industries.

    Nestled in the Alexander valley, the small Sonoma County town of Geyserville is on its way to a fully-funded program and site for outdoor classrooms, farming, science, and technical programs for students with a farm-to-table kitchen, farmer’s market, and community center.

    Bertolucci joins Clark Wolf for a conversation that covers how students learn about growing, planting, harvesting, working, cooking, and nutrition.
